In 2025, the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O) implemented several measures to enhance player safety and maintain market integrity in online gaming:

  • Updated Registrar Standards for Online Gaming:In January 2025, AGCO updated these standards, focusing on documentation and auditability. Cybersecurity policies must include incident response plans and regular penetration tests, along with disclosure and mitigation protocols for high-risk jurisdictions.

  • Separation of iGaming Ontario (iGO):In May 2025, iGO became an independent agency, separating from AGCO. This move aims to enhance operational autonomy and foster growth in Ontario’s online gaming market.

  • Strengthened Oversight of International Operators:AGCO increased enforcement against unlicensed operators abroad, issuing warnings and taking action to protect consumers and ensure gaming integrity.

  • Responsible Gambling Training Updates:In July 2025, AGCO revised its responsible gambling training standards, removing the need for formal program approval to reduce administrative barriers while maintaining strong player safeguards.
